I am disappointed with this subwoofer. It just doesn't live up to that Klipsch reputation that I have come to know. Let me start with looks. The style is very simple and modern, just like the other speakers in this series. It has a smooth finish and is black on black. The grille is also black and has plastic pegs to hold it in place to cover the subwoofer driver in the front. The pegs feel a bit cheap and breakable, which is why I have never really been a fan of them. I understand they need it to stay in place but feel like they could have used a stronger set of magnets to secure it like the speakers in this reference series. The driver is nice look look at with that copper color. The size of the surround on the driver is built well and looks good. The connectivity is a limited with only RCA inputs to connect it to the LFE output on your receiver or pre-amp. It stinks that there aren't line level inputs to hook up to older receivers or an integrated amp for a two channel music setup. That would have been a great feature. Now, the sound. I'm not fan. It either lacks or is too muddy. There isn't much of a sweet spot for the gain, crossover and phase. I have played several action and horror movies and it just doesn't do well with it's overall sound. For the price of this thing, I feel like there is much better for the same amount. Overall, this was a bit of a disappointment.

The subwoofer works well with my Bose music amplifier and Klipsch floor soeakers. The bass response is excellent, and there are many songs that have subbase that I didn’t even realize existed in the song tracks. I was able to purchase this at half price and is an excellent investment. You can easily hear down to 28 Hz and can hear all the way down to 20 but at less decibels. I noticed sound of my floor speakers, the mid range and travel is much cleaner since the subwoofer takes over a lot of the base with the floor speakers do not have to work that hard.
